Boosters are powerful passives in Helldivers 2 that players equip before deploying into missions. Think of them as tactical modifiers that affect the whole squad, ranging from increased health and stamina to improved mobility and radar range, among other benefits.
Some boosters work in combination to provide enhanced utility and support, while others are special enough on their own to warrant a slot. Firebomb Hellpods may as well be a booster designed for players to troll each other. It causes every Hellpod to land with an explosion, dealing incendiary damage to everyone (and everything) in a small radius.
It so happens that most players often forget about the booster and end up killing themselves when their support weapons arrive. Even worse than the mass friendly fire is that the booster reduces the physical damage a Hellpod usually does on impact. With so many negatives, Firebomb Hellpods solely exist as a fiery gimmick.

In theory, being able to reinforce players more times than normal sounds like a good idea. However, if players are dying more than the allotted 20 times, they are doing something wrong. Maybe their Terminid loadouts are not packing enough firepower to deal with armored enemies, or there's too much friendly fire.
That said,
Increased Reinforcement Budget has to be one of the worst boosters in Helldivers 2. It only increases initial reinforcements by 1 per player. That’s hardly worth sacrificing a valuable booster slot, especially when there are so many better options available.

Yet another booster that desperately needs a rework,
Expert Extraction Pilot lowers the time it takes for Pelican-1 to arrive at the extraction beacon. However, players will only be saving around 18 to 37 seconds on 2- to 4-minute extraction timers. If a team can hold out for nearly 2 minutes, they can hold out for an additional 18 seconds. The harsh truth is that this booster is not worth unlocking.

Helldivers 2 cuts down the number of reinforcements players can use to respawn themselves at higher difficulties. While the Flexible Reinforcement Budget booster helps reduce the time until new reinforcements are granted, it only shaves off around 12 seconds. That slight reduction rarely makes a meaningful difference, making this booster one of the least impactful options in the game.

It's in the name.
Localization Confusion is a rather confusingly designed booster that increases the time between enemy encounters. Understand that it does not reduce enemy spawns. It only delays the next enemy reinforcement call, such as the first Automaton Dropship flying in or the first Terminid bug burrowing out of a breach.
Localization Confusion can be somewhat useful in defense and eradication missions. However, its impact is highly situational, making it one of the less reliable boosters in most mission types.

Motivational Shocks is a highly situational booster in Helldivers 2. It reduces slowing effects to help players recover faster. The problem is that the booster only works for acid attacks, seismic tremors, and dense foliage.
Muscle Enhancement does this better and more. It not only mitigates the same slowing effects but also improves movement through mud, snow, blizzards, and even uphill terrain. For players looking to boost mobility across a wider range of conditions, Muscle Enhancement is simply the better choice.

Sentries and Guard Dogs are the best stratagems in Helldivers 2 to watch a player's flank. However, for those looking for something else, Armored Resupply Pods offer a somewhat decent fallback. The booster attaches a Liberator Penetrator rifle to every Resupply Pod that will automatically fire on any enemy within 30 meters, providing some additional firepower.
However, it's no substitute for an actual sentry. If players are serious about holding a position, they are better off bringing the real thing.

The mini-map in Helldivers 2 only reveals enemies that are near the player. The
UAV Recon booster helps increase this radar range by 50 percent, giving players a significantly greater scanning radius. While helpful in avoiding patrolling enemies, the UAV Recon only works for the player equipping it, and not the entire squad, limiting its overall effectiveness.
For stealth-loving players, combine the UAV Recon booster with the Scout armor passive to sneak past enemies and locate objectives faster on the map.

Some planets have rough terrain and weather conditions that make it difficult for players to traverse.
Muscle Enhancement helps overcome these obstacles by negating movement penalties when moving through snow, mud, foliage, blizzards, sandstorms, etc. The booster also reduces movement-impairing effects like the acid attacks from Terminids, allowing players to recover more quickly, no matter what the environment throws at them.

This is easily one of the top five boosters in Helldivers 2 at any given time.
Experimental Infusion gives players specially enhanced stims that heal, increase movement speed, and reduce damage taken for a few seconds. These experimental stims allow players to defy death, giving them a literal burst of survivability and mobility in the middle of combat. Never leave home without them.
Experimental Infusion stims also restore all stamina, so consider injecting one to reach the objective faster.
